#2c0171 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c0171 is composed of 17.3% red, 0.4%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.1%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 263 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 22.4%. #2c0171 color hex could be obtained by blending #5802e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2c0171 color description : Very dark violet.

#2c0171 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2c0171 has RGB values of R:44, G:1,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2883953.

Shades and Tints of #2c0171

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060010 is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c0171

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#38363c is the less saturated color, while #2c0171 is the most saturated one.
